555 ile sinüs sinyali hk.

Başlatan zamzam23, 14 Eylül 2019, 09:16:01

zamzam23

Selamlar,
555 zamanlayıcı entegresi ile 5khz 3V genlikli tam sinüs sinyali gerekiyor. İnternette baya bir araştırdım. Farklı bağlantı şekilleri ile devreler buldum. Birkaçını denedim fakat istediğim sonucu alamadım. En son kurduğum devrede 3khz fakat simetrik olmayan bir sinyal elde ettim.

Elinde daha önceden denenmiş ve çalışan 555'li sinüs üreteç devresi var mı?

Veya 555 yerine başka entegre önerisi de alabilirim.

Sozuak

#1
Ille entegreli diyorsaniz icl8038 vardi piyasada uretec olarak. Bunun disinda wien osilator devresi diye aratirsaniz tekil elemanlarla daha basit devrelerde (maliyet olarak) cikabiliyor.

diot

xr2206, icl8038 kullanabilirsin 2 side piyasada var. Yada rc faz kaydırmalı transistörlü bir osilatör kurabilirsin.

M.Salim GÜLLÜCE

#3
555 ile %50 lik duty ile karedalga elde edemezsen elde edeceğin sinüs te yetersiz dengesiz olur.
aşağıdaki şema ile değerler üzerinde istediğin frekansı elde edecek şekilde uğraş derim.


En kaliteli sinüs ise 3 aşamalı olarak opamplar ile yapılabilir.

zamzam23

Gönderdiğin 3 opamplı devrede frekans nasıl hesaplanır?

M.Salim GÜLLÜCE

Alıntı yapılan: zamzam23 - 15 Eylül 2019, 00:20:06Gönderdiğin 3 opamplı devrede frekans nasıl hesaplanır?
Açıkçası bende bilmiyorum.
Araştırıp bularak söylerim.
Ama daha kolay yolunu sana söyleyebilirim.
Proteusta birinci opampi devre olarak kur. Frekansını öğrenirsin oradan.
Direnç ve kapasitör değişimiyle istediğin değeri elde edersin.

Sonra 2. ve 3. opampleri ekleyerek geri besleme kapasitörlerini istediğin kaliteyi yaklacak şekilde değiştirirsin.
Gerçeğe yakın sonuç alacağından eminim.

z

En kaliteli sinus icin 3 opamp onerisine katilmiyorum.

3 opampli sistemde birinci opamp kare dalga isaret uretir. Ikinci opamp bunu integer ederek ucgen dalgaya cevirir. Ucuncu opamp ise ucgen dalgayi filitre ederek ana harmonigi ceker cikartir. Fakat digger harmonikler filitreden zayiflayarak gectigi icin hala sinyal harmoniklere sahiptir.

Halbuki kaliteli sinus sinyali safkan sinus olmalidir. Bu da harmonic icermemesi gerektigi anlamina gelir.

3. Opamp cikisina eklenecek ikinci bir filitre harmonikleri iyice bastirir sinyalin kalitesi artar.

Fakat isin icinde teknik zorluklar var.

1. opamp ile elde edilen f frekansli sinyal, ikinci opamp ile integer edilirken integer edilmis sinyal genligi 2 kattaki R,C ve kare dalga frekansi ile orantilidir. Dolayisi ile 1. opamp ile uretilen sinyalin frekansini biraz degistirirseniz integrator cikisindaki sinyalin genligi degisir.

3.kattaki filitrenin kesim frekansi ozenle hesaplanip R,C degerleri ozenle secildigi icin sinyal frekansi azicik degisse filitre frekansi ile ana harmonic frekansi uyumsuz hale gelir.

Kisacasi ilk opampli devrede frekans degistirildigi zaman hem integrator R,C degeri hem de filitrenin R,C degeri degistirilmelidir.

Bu da pratikte hic kolay is degil. Cunku her bir frekans icin hesaplanan R, C degerleri acaip kusuratli degerler olacak.

Bu 3 opampli yapida 2. ve 3. katin RC degerleri ile oynamazsaniz 1. katta frekansi degistirken cikis sinyalinin genliginin degistigini ve sinus kalitesinin bozuldugunu goreceksiniz.

Wien Bridge kullanan RC osilatore bakabilirsin. Fakat bunda da tum analog osilatorlerde oldugu gibi R,C nin sicaklikla degisimi gibi sorunu olacak.
Bana e^st de diyebilirsiniz.   www.cncdesigner.com

sinus

Sinus üretmek çok gıcık bir iş. Ben zamanında paralel bağlı LC'ye pwm yardımıyla pulse vererek yapmıştım. Duty değeri %1-2-3 civarında frekans ise LC frekansına yakındı. Böylelikle sinusun güzelliğini ayarlayabiliyordum.

En güzeli opamlı Wein köprüydü galiba. Ayıca colpitts osilatörde güzel sonuçlar verebiliyor. Geri beslemeyi ayarlayarak güzel sinüsler üretebiliyorsunuz.

ICl8038 veya XR2206 orjinalleri piyasada var mı bilmiyorum. ICL8038 güvenilir kaynaklarda artık yok.



power20


Devrede pic varsa, 1 periyodluk sinüs datası(örnek değerleri) tablo olarak hafızaya atılır.   
PWM çıkışından itinayla dışarı verilir. Frekans ayarlanabilir.
https://www.picproje.org/index.php?topic=27970.0

Alıntı yapılan: zamzam23 - 14 Eylül 2019, 09:16:01555 yerine başka entegre önerisi de alabilirim.

zamzam23

Öneriler için teşekkürler.
Devrede mikrodenetleyici yok malesef olsa pwm ile yapacaktım.

Şuan gerçek ortamda wien osilatör ile  tepeleri kesik bir sinüs elde ettim bakalım düzeltebilirsem düzelticem yoksa böyle kullanırım.

M.Salim GÜLLÜCE

#10
walla o kadar gerdirmeye kastırmaya gerek yok.
@z açıkçası arkadaş sabit bir frekanstan bahsettiği için önerileri çeşitlendirmeye çalıştım.
Fonksıyon jeneratörü gibi kullanmayı düşünüyorlarsa zaten bedava denecekj kadar uzcuza internetten satınalabilr.
xr2206-function-generator.

https://tr.aliexpress.com/item/32962647097.html




XR2206 entegreyi bu fiyata alamazsınız.